Window Cost by Type

When it comes to upgrading your windows, value is most important. Each window you purchase should provide top-notch durability at a fair price point. Although premium replacement windows may be more expensive to buy, they often yield better long-term value due to their longer lifespan. The age of your home, as well as the sizes, styles, and materials of replacement windows you select, can influence pricing. Transom windows are inexpensive with their simple size and straightforward form factor, while a sweeping, custom-size picture window will cost more. A professional can help you with selecting the solutions that fit your preferences.

In this table, you can find cost data for the most common residential window types to determine how much you might pay.

Window TypesAverage Cost
Arched$234-$1439
Awning$339-$945
Bay$782-$5801
Custom$348-$966
Casement$270-$1568
Double-hung$126-$816
Egress$232-$579
Glass Block$46-$587
Picture$203-$1504
Single-hung$91-$1547
Skylight$116-$1396
Sliding$266-$1353
Storm$55-$382
Transom$283-$593

Window Material Cost

Replacement window prices also vary based on material. Each option offers different benefits depending on the local climate and energy efficiency needs. Vinyl and fiberglass are readily-available materials, so they tend to cost less. Likewise, composites and aluminum look sleek and stay strong against the elements, so they tend to cost more.

Window TypesAverage Cost
Aluminum$55-$1547
Composite$558-$1254
Fiberglass$91-$782
Vinyl$188-$1740
Wood$279-$1568

Licensing and Credentials

New York's state government doesn't issue contracting licenses for window installers, but this hasn't stopped local governments from intervening and setting up their own licenses. For example, to place windows in New York City, a company must obtain a Home Improvement Contractor License by passing exams and environmental audits.

Frequently Asked Questions About Window Replacement in Brighton

Why should I hire a professional to install or replace my windows?

By working with an expert, you don't need to worry about making measurement mistakes or not having the right tools. A window installation team is well-equipped with the right supplies and skills to do the job safely and precisely. You can also get fast, informed answers to your questions and tailored guidance to make the most of your new windows

How frequently should I upgrade or replace my windows?

Refer to your product warranty to best understand how long your windows are meant to last. Most home windows have life spans of 15–20 years. Check your windows for damage, leaks, and subpar performance to determine whether your windows should be swapped out.

How important are guarantees and extended support packages?

We strongly recommend choosing a window company that backs their work with a guarantee for your protection. These plans usually cover workmanship errors, material flaws, and manufacturer defects that appear after installation. Check the warranty details with a window company before hiring it.
